However, some message attributes are defined using relatively loose types for strong compatibility. For example, the transaction type is defined as short, but its actual value may only be a limited set of values.

In Java, setting or identifying the appropriate value can be confusing without the assistance of enumeration types.

Currently, if a defined enumeration type is not used in a message, sbe-tool will not generate Java code.

Is it possible to remove this constraint, or make it a configurable option?
